Technical Considerations and Cautions

While this asset is powerful, it requires careful handling to maintain professional quality. As a Cricut and Silhouette user, I always check the technical details before finalizing any design for sale.

Avoid Crowded Compositions: Do not place intricate, thin-lined clipart or complex layered vinyl designs on this mock-up if they are small. The texture of the hoodie fabric in the image can obscure fine details. Keep your shapes bold and simple for the best visual impact.

Check Contrast and Colors: Always preview your PNG design with transparency on both light and dark variations if available. If the hoodie is a mid-tone brown or rust, ensure your text is not a similar shade. High contrast is key for readability in product photos.

Resolution Matters: Confirm the resolution of the mock-up file. If you are using it for large format printing or high-resolution web banners, ensure it does not pixelate when scaled. For print-on-demand previews, standard web resolution is usually sufficient, but for printed lookbooks, you need high DPI.
